Mission of the Position:
The MENA Head of Department Emergency Response is responsible for coordinating and directing the MENA Emergency Response department and is responsible for providing advice, support and surge capacity for emergency response programmes in Member Association countries in the region. S/he is responsible for leading on the development of emergency response interventions in the region, monitoring the humanitarian situation and global trends that may affect countries in the MENA as well as supporting to ensure adequate funding is secured to implement high quality, accountable responses. Operationally s/he supports the development and monitoring of emergency programmes, building capacity of Member Associations and MENA Emergency Response team members. S/he is responsible for ensuring that the strategic direction of SOS CVI emergency programmes in the region are aligned to international emergency response plans such as the 3RP, UNHCR and OCHA Country Plans etc.
Job Description Summary:
- Responsible for ensuring efficient and accountable in-field operations through the supervision of the MENA Region Emergency Response Advisors/Coordinator(s) responsible for coordinating the field Project Advisors/Coordinators;
- Together with the MENA IOR Finance Department, responsible for ensuring funding transfers are traceable and correctly utilized according to project budgets and outlines;
- Together with the MENA IOR Finance Department, responsible for monitoring and approving adjustments to project spending;
- Responsible for reporting to the IDR and the International Director of Emergency Response on any important issues occurring in the field programmes that need high-level decision-making stakeholders involved;
- Responsible for ensuring good PSA relations and institutional and PSA donor reporting is completed timely;
- Responsible for elaborating project templates and procedures for use both in the IRO and in the field;
- Responsible for elaborating policy and position papers;
- Responsible for meeting the training needs of MA teams in ERP project cycle management, child protection in emergencies;
- Responsible for ensuring PSAs receive project information when requested;
- Actively involved in establishing links and working relationships with international coalitions working in the MENA region;
- Actively involved in the recruitment of Project Advisors/Coordinators in the field;
